Forward Bounded Hierarchical Portable-Matchup Contextual RAPM
This candidate applies the bounded contextual-function strategy to the portable decomposition used by the Lineup Lab:
It retains the identifiable portable composition scores \(h\) and the opponent-specific matchup residual \(q\), while constraining both to the central support observed in each completed season.
Bounded Support
For every side-level profile feature, the completed season supplies possession-weighted 5th and 95th percentile bounds. Both lineup profiles are capped to those bounds before calculating the relative matchup features. Each relative feature is then capped symmetrically at its possession-weighted 95th percentile absolute magnitude:
The symmetric matchup cap is essential: it retains \(C(A,B)=-C(B,A)\) exactly. The same clipping occurs when the model is used as the next season's contextual offset, during the projected temporal prior, and in the reference-anchored \(h/q\) decomposition.
Seasonal Recursion
The estimator re-runs from 1996-97 through 2025-26. Every completed season fits a bounded P-spline context state with level, curvature, and temporal function penalties. Its player state and contextual function become inputs to the following season only. Consequently the frozen 2025-26 evaluation uses the completed 2024-25 bounded state; the 2025-26 fit is retained solely for a subsequent forecast.
Frozen Result
The completed frozen 2025-26 evaluation records a regular eligible-game margin RMSE of 14.5953, a full-game margin RMSE of 14.9224, and a Pythagorean win-total RMSE of 9.4360. This improves materially on the unconstrained portable decomposition, but does not surpass the unbounded hierarchical portable model on the current frozen metrics. Its benefit is a consistent inference contract: the model itself caps out-of-support inputs, rather than leaving visualizations to handle extrapolation separately.

Relative-Context Agreement Audit
This is a possession-weighted agreement audit on the observed 2025-26 regular-season matchup stints. It is not a frozen predictive comparison: both completed 2025-26 fits score the same lineups with their own player coefficients, profiles, and context functions.
The portable model's net context edge is \(C(A,B)=h(A)-h(B)+q(A,B)\). The relative-context reference's net context edge is \(g(x(A)-x(B))\). Thus the table tests whether the two separately trained decompositions agree on the same realized lineup field; it does not establish that either estimate is correct.

Each dot is one observed stint. The axes use each model's net edge in points per 100 possessions; dot area is capped square-root stint possessions. The plot uses a deterministic 10% sample, while the gray dashed line, orange possession-weighted least-squares fit, and table all use the full stint field.
| Component | Weighted Pearson | Weighted Spearman | RMSE | MAE |
|---|---|---|---|---|
| Net player rating edge | 0.9991 | 0.9990 | 0.390 | 0.310 |
| Net context edge | 0.9344 | 0.9307 | 1.278 | 1.019 |
| Predicted net rating | 0.9935 | 0.9931 | 1.256 | 1.004 |
Feature-Level Agreement
Both contextual functions are additive over the same 20 original features. For each feature, this audit compares the portable model's total feature contribution, which is its composition contribution plus its matchup residual, with the relative model's contribution to \(g(x(A)-x(B))\). Each model's 20 contributions sum exactly to its net context edge. This is therefore an attribution-agreement diagnostic, not a comparison of the portable-only composition term \(h(A)-h(B)\), for which the relative model has no analog.
| Feature | Weighted Pearson | Weighted Spearman | RMSE | MAE |
|---|---|---|---|---|
| Rebounding-by-usage | 0.9918 | 0.9941 | 0.374 | 0.323 |
| Turnovers | 0.9913 | 0.9939 | 0.229 | 0.186 |
| Blocks | 0.9887 | 0.9789 | 0.123 | 0.084 |
| Three-point attempt volume | 0.9840 | 0.9928 | 0.209 | 0.171 |
| Steals | 0.9698 | 0.9949 | 0.423 | 0.300 |
| Usage events | 0.9664 | 0.9932 | 0.358 | 0.270 |
| Shooting-by-usage | 0.9400 | 0.9937 | 0.347 | 0.242 |
| Imputed-profile count | 0.9345 | 0.9863 | 0.373 | 0.251 |
| Three-point makes | 0.9212 | 0.9071 | 0.387 | 0.306 |
| Diminishing offensive rebounding | 0.9168 | 0.9794 | 0.359 | 0.245 |
| Top-two assists | 0.9125 | 0.9065 | 0.201 | 0.178 |
| Offensive rebounds | 0.9027 | 0.9597 | 0.157 | 0.129 |
| Diminishing defensive rebounding | 0.7095 | 0.8601 | 0.136 | 0.100 |
| Defensive rebounds | 0.5733 | 0.6573 | 0.139 | 0.098 |
| Replacement-profile weight | 0.5109 | 0.3411 | 0.544 | 0.420 |
| Assists | -0.0091 | 0.2709 | 0.660 | 0.490 |
| Bottom-two three-point makes | -0.0135 | 0.0578 | 0.592 | 0.463 |
| Credible-shooter count | -0.0984 | 0.0185 | 0.880 | 0.684 |
| Usage concentration | -0.1345 | 0.1085 | 0.401 | 0.297 |
| Shooter-by-passing | -0.8096 | -0.8423 | 0.709 | 0.602 |


The atlases use the same deterministic 10% stint sample for dots, but every reported metric and orange fit uses the full possession-weighted stint field. The gray dashed line marks exact contribution agreement.
The audit includes 39,918 stints representing 122,886.0 possessions. RMSE and MAE are in net-rating points per 100 possessions.
